Junk food has become part of the lifestyle of today's society. People choose junk food because it is practical and tastes good. Junk food is available in various kinds of food and beverage products that are packaged and advertised attractively. However, junk food does not provide balanced nutritional content. Junk food contains calories that exceed the daily needs of the body, but lack of other nutritional necessities, such as vitamins and minerals. The excessive consumption of junk food in the long term might increase the risk of various non-communicable diseases, such as hypertension, organ dysfunction, and diabetes. Many kinds of methods can be done to reduce junk food consumption, for examples, limiting junk food purchase, eating fruits and vegetables, increasing mineral water consumption, fasting, and etcetera. Even so, people still experience many challenges in their efforts to go on healthier eating patterns, for instances, the temptations from the surrounding environment, too many activities, lack of self-discipline, and limited food choices.
